## Deploying the Gatewick Proctor Queue

Deploys are pretty painless: push to main, wait for the pipeline, then watch the queue drain dashboard for five minutes. If candidates pile up mid-exam, roll back first and ask questions later — the queue replays safely. Everything the workers care about lives in one config block, shown here for reference.

settings of bafof-yagef:
JOROX_PIN=8740
JOROX_TENANT=pelox
JOROX_METRICS_HOST=metrics.jorox.qorvelworks.internal
JOROX_SEAL=seal_c78f63c1
JOROX_STANDBY_TEAM=norax

Handover Note — Director Transition

From Maren Oduyele to Callis Brandt: the Ferrowane product line retires over eighteen months. Customer migrations to the Aldercast platform are 40% complete; warranty obligations run until year-end. Supplier exits are documented and signed. Board members should note the commercial reasoning recorded immediately below.

management briefing: Project Ulavan slips by two quarters because of the staffing delay.

## Capacity note: cold starts on Fernwick handlers

Quick heads-up for whoever inherits this: our serverless handlers on the Quillbank platform cold-start slower than you'd hope, mostly due to the big schema registry load. We keep a small warm pool during business hours and let it drain overnight. Don't bump pool sizes without checking the billing dashboard first. Current settings are as follows.

constants for fajop-tahaf:
RATE_LIMITS = {
    "holael": 2,
    "oliael": 10,
    "druael": 10,
    "wenwyn": 10,
}

**Action Item 4: Document BranchSweeper override procedure**

During the incident, support agents could not pause BranchSweeper when it began archiving active release branches, extending customer impact by roughly two hours. Owner: platform tooling team. Due: end of next sprint. The team will publish a step-by-step override and pause procedure that support can execute without engineering escalation, including rollback of wrongly archived branches. Once complete, the procedure will be available at the internal page linked below.

dashboard of tawef-hagug = https://superset.norvadyn.local/display/projects/build/ticket/build/spaces/ticket/1e989f0e6c200d20fc4ae06b